Dear Anne,
Constant Southworth of Plymouth Colony is my 8th great grandfather and about 1940 my mother's cousin George Southworth [1890-1972] was in England setting up radar sites. At that time he completed his family history research and so my records show: Conatant [1615], son of Edward [1590], son of Sir Thomas & Rosamond Lister, son of Sir John & Mary (Ashton) Gouland. According to George, Sir Thomas & Rosmond had nine children and he reported none by Sir Thomas' first wife, Bridget Pigot.
Much has changed in research accuracy in the last sixty years. I hope that you can help me sort and correct my data. I'm also interested in where John Southworth [1592-1654] fits into the Southworth Family of that era. I figure that Father John became a martyr & saint while his cousin Edward [1590-1621] became a Puritan.
Any illumination you can give these matters will be much appriciated.
